Traveling from Morpeth to Ponteland is a short 15-kilometer journey across the Northumberland countryside. Most commuters prefer driving via the A1 and B6524, which takes roughly 20 minutes. Public transport options include local bus services that connect the two towns via smaller villages. The route is straightforward and passes through pleasant rural landscapes. It is a common route for those accessing Newcastle International Airport, which lies between the two locations.
Total Distance: 15 km driving distance, 13 km straight-line air distance.
